It is vital that potential victims and their family members submit a claim before the time limit expiring. An experienced lawyer will be able to avoid this mistake and will assist them in filing an action before it's too late. Families of victims can pursue a variety of mesothelioma suits. These include personal injury, wrongful death, and trust fund claims. The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are filed as individual lawsuits rather than class action lawsuits. It is because mesothelioma sufferers get more compensation from individual lawsuits. After a lawsuit is settled, the proceeds will be distributed to the plaintiffs. If medical professionals have imposed liens, these must be paid prior the funds being released. The amount you can receive depends on the state you reside in and the mesothelioma type. There are three types of mesothelioma lawsuits which include personal injury, wrongful deaths and trust funds. A personal injury lawsuit seeks compensation from the defendant that caused your condition. This is the most common mesothelioma type of lawsuit. Wrongful death claims are filed by family members of mesothelioma patients and seek compensation from the company or companies responsible for the victim's death. A mesothelioma trust fund claim can be filed through one of the many asbestos trust funds that have been established by the government or individual asbestos companies. A lawsuit can take years to resolve. A fair settlement may be difficult to negotiate. Certain asbestos companies try to delay the process by filing frivolous lawsuits. Your mesothelioma lawyer is skilled at identifying these tactics and thwarting them. There are different statutes which apply based on the state in which you live and what type of asbestos exposure you had. Some states have shorter time limits, whereas others have longer timeframes to file a lawsuit. A mesothelioma lawsuit can last for several years. If the plaintiff is seriously ill or has a low life expectancy, judges can expedite the trial. The judge who is in charge will decide whether there is a valid reason to speed up the process. The court will then ordain the defendants to reply to the plaintiff's claims.
